Motilal Oswal Report
Cholamandalam Investment and Finance Company Ltd. reported 5% YoY growth in profit after tax to Rs 4.1 billion (in-line).
Operating profit grew 51% YoY, 11% above our expectation. However, higher-than-expected provisions (Rs 4.45 billion versus Rs 3.5 billion) drove PAT in-line.
We expect the company to deliver asset under management growth in the low-to-mid teens in the medium term.
The margin should expand given lower cost of funds and reduced liquidity on the balance sheet.
The 100 basis points QoQ increase in the proforma gross non-performing loan ratio is commendable in the current environment.
